Automating Compliance Monitoring for Enhanced Risk Management

In today's dynamic business environment, organizations face a multitude of compliance requirements. Ensuring adherence to these demanding standards is crucial for mitigating associated risks and safeguarding brand image. Automating compliance monitoring has emerged as a strategic approach to improve risk management processes. By leveraging technology, organizations can effectively track compliance activities, flag potential violations in real time, and generate comprehensive reports for assessments. This proactive approach lowers the likelihood of non-compliance, allowing businesses to prioritize on their core operations

Elevating Staff Productivity Through Workflow Automation in Legal Services

Legal experts are constantly aiming for ways to enhance efficiency and productivity. With the growing volume of matters and the rigorous nature of legal work, finding methods to streamline workflows is vital. Workflow automation has emerged as a effective tool for securing these targets in the legal field. By automating repetitive tasks, such as document creation, communication with clients, and file organization, legal teams can free up valuable time for strategic work. This therefore leads to enhanced staff productivity, minimized turnaround times, and an overall more efficient legal operation.

Financial Services Automation: Driving Efficiency and Accuracy

In today's rapidly evolving financial landscape, automation is transforming the industry by optimizing operations and boosting efficiency. By leveraging advanced technologies such as robotic process automation (RPA) and artificial intelligence (AI), financial institutions can automate repetitive tasks, reduce manual errors, and improve overall accuracy. Automation empowers employees to focus on more analytical initiatives, ultimately leading to enhanced customer satisfaction and a competitive edge.
